Not enough disk space on drive C: to install KB885835

Some updates, including KB885835 require more disk space on drive C: then I
have. Using the the /n switch (no backup) solved the problem until now, but
KB885835 seems to need even more space on drive C:.

I get the following message:

There is not enough disk space on C: to install KB885835. Setup requires
a minimum of 5 additional megabytes of free space or if you also want to
archive the files for uninstallation, Setup requires 15 additional megabytes
of free space. Free additional space on your hard disk and then try again.

The relevant lines from the log are:

8.542: Allocation size of drive D: is 4096 bytes, free space = 10663268352
bytes
8.542: Allocation size of drive C: is 2048 bytes, free space = 31266816
bytes
8.542: Drive C: free 29MB req: 34MB w/uninstall 0MB
8.552: LoadFileQueues: SetupGetSourceFileLocation for halacpi.dll failed:
0xe0000102
8.763: Error: Drive C: free 29MB req: 34MB w/uninstall 44MB
8.763: Drive C: Need additional 5MB to install, 15MB with uninstall
8.763: DoInstallation:AnalyzeDiskUsage failed
8.803: VerifySize: Unable to verify size: Source = NULL: d:\winnt\oem32.cat
9.143: There is not enough disk space on C: to install KB885835. Setup
requires a minimum of 5 ....

This is all correct, since my C: drive only has 30MB (just holds the files
for booting).

Is there any hidden switch to tell the update to use space on drive D:
instead of drive C: ?
